Legal and Advisory Teams

Enhabit is being advised by Jones Day, with a team led by partners Andy Levine and Darcy White, alongside partner Ferrell Keel.

Kinderhook is represented by Kirkland & Ellis LLP. The firm’s advisory bench spans multiple disciplines: corporate partners Marshall Shaffer, Tom Marbury, Steven Choi and Kartik Khanna; debt finance partners Yongjin Im and Justin Greer; executive compensation partner Stephen Brecher; healthcare partners Dennis Williams and Micah Desaire; tax partner Ben Schreiner; antitrust and competition partners Ian John and Sam Morelli; employee benefits partner Chris Chase; labor and employment partner Mari Stonebraker; and technology and IP transactions partner Daisy Darvall.
